Output 823f715fec2df4f2dd3ed079797a00d85de7c01f9d99a4ff0eab00504338bf41:14

value
136786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58152fe24179f79e9a893d6bc65dde5ef289161 OP_EQUAL
address
3Q58Q9LHxdknG6gbdAPpstXoxnoReBuSFA
transaction
823f715fec2df4f2dd3ed079797a00d85de7c01f9d99a4ff0eab00504338bf41